    If it is a potted osmanthus, too much water will lose the leaves, and reducing the water will not; Too much fertilizer will also fall leaves, thin fertilizer is applied frequently, no lack of application, can make osmanthus do not fall leaves;

    In addition, low temperature frost damage in winter will also lead to leaf fall, so that the winter warmth and cold protection can make the osmanthus do not fall leaves.

    If osmanthus is planted in the ground, brown spot disease causes defoliation, you can spray 500-800 times carbendazim control, if the fertilization is too close or too much to cause fertilizer to fall leaves, the seedlings should be dug up and replanted, properly cut off part of the leaves, and not fertilized, and wait for a year after the tree body recovers and then apply;

    In some areas, the soil layer is thin, and the soil compaction is prone to drought due to lack of water, and such plots are also prone to leaf loss, so they should be moved to other places for planting or soil replanting;

    In some areas, the sandy nature is heavy, the water retention performance is weak, and it is easy to cause leaf litter, so the surface should be covered with sand after filling the yellow loam around the tree disk.

    1. Improper planting season Osmanthus likes warmth, if transplanted when the temperature is low, the plant is easy to cause a large number of leaves due to lack of water. If the osmanthus has been sprouted and has long leaves, and in dry weather, and is not planted in time, watering, and proper pruning, it will also cause leaf fall.

    2. Too arid When the soil is too dry, the plant sheds a large number of leaves in order to adapt to the environment.

    3. Too wet and waterlogged Excessive soil moisture affects the normal life activities of plant roots, and is easy to cause a large number of leaf drops, and even root rot.

    4. Excessive fertilization will cause leaf loss due to root injury.

    When osmanthus leaves fall due to excessive watering, it is necessary to loosen the soil in time to evaporate water and prune the eroded root system, and if the leaves fall due to too little watering, it needs to be replenished in time. When osmanthus burns its roots and causes defoliation due to excessive fertilization, it is necessary to change the soil and prune the root system in time, because the nutrients are insufficient to fall the leaves, it is necessary to supplement fertilizer in time.

    Improper watering is one of the main reasons for osmanthus leaf loss, when excessive watering leads to osmanthus root erosion and leaf fall, it is necessary to shovel the soil in time to promote water evaporation, and at the same time prune the eroded root system. When too little watering leads to a serious lack of water and leaves of osmanthus, it is necessary to replenish water for osmanthus in time.

    Osmanthus leaf loss may also be caused by improper fertilization, too much fertilization will lead to the burning of osmanthus roots, at this time it is necessary to repair the root system of osmanthus in time, and replace it with new soil. When too little fertilization leads to the lack of nutrients and leaves of osmanthus plants, it is necessary to fertilize osmanthus in time to supplement nutrients.

    In addition, osmanthus defoliation may also be caused by insufficient light, if osmanthus grows in a dark environment for a long time, osmanthus will lose its leaves because it cannot carry out enough photosynthesis. In this case, it is necessary to move the osmanthus to a well-lit place in time for maintenance, so that the osmanthus can return to its normal growth state.

    Soil compaction is also one of the common causes of osmanthus leaf fall, soil compaction will lead to soil hardening, fertilizer and water will not be able to penetrate around the root system of osmanthus for a long time, and it will lead to osmanthus because there is not enough nutrients and water to fall leaves, at this time the soil also needs to be replaced.
